Output 39296321209260bf2a3dfd439aa1778df905568cd58dffd29a0373314c09bb36:1

value
528541
script pubkey
OP_0 OP_PUSHBYTES_32 c14abb3f9d35bbed588f0add6bee7a26aa2adda1f96fddf219c6997ea8fdb5e7
address
bc1qc99tk0uaxka76ky0ptwkhmn6y64z4hdpl9hamusec6vha28akhnsu68ndx
transaction
39296321209260bf2a3dfd439aa1778df905568cd58dffd29a0373314c09bb36
spent
true